About The Orthopedic Physical Therapy Residency Program

This 12-month clinical program is designed to advance the skills of physical therapists through direct patient care, structured mentorship, and advanced coursework. Our residents gain hands-on experience across outpatient orthopedic settings while developing the knowledge and leadership skills needed to become specialists and future thought leaders in the field.

Mission Statement

Lattimore Physical Therapy’s Orthopedic Residency Program was founded in an effort to enhance the orthopedic care provided to every patient that chooses Lattimore PT for their rehabilitation needs.  This program will provide an educational opportunity to develop residents’ critical thinking to strengthen clinical reasoning and teaching skills in order to promote exceptional patient care and leadership within the company and the profession. Faculty, mentors, and residents will collaborate to advance clinical knowledge and professional growth in the field of orthopedic physical therapy with the goal of producing clinicians who not only deliver exceptional patient care but also take on leadership roles within the company and the profession.
